II. The Rise of E-commerce

The e-commerce industry has witnessed exponential growth over the past decade, with global online sales reaching trillions of dollars. According to recent statistics, e-commerce sales accounted for over 20% of total retail sales in 2022, a figure that continues to rise. Several factors contribute to this growth, including the convenience and accessibility of online shopping, technological advancements, and changing consumer behavior.

A. Growth Statistics and Market Analysis

The e-commerce market has expanded significantly, driven by increased internet penetration and smartphone usage. In 2023, it is estimated that over 2.14 billion people worldwide will be online shoppers. This growth is not just limited to established markets; emerging economies are also experiencing a surge in online shopping, fueled by a growing middle class and improved logistics.

B. Factors Driving the Growth of Online Shopping

1. **Convenience and Accessibility**: Online shopping allows consumers to browse and purchase products from the comfort of their homes, eliminating the need to visit physical stores. This convenience is particularly appealing to busy individuals and those living in remote areas.

2. **Technological Advancements**: Innovations in technology, such as mobile apps, secure payment gateways, and user-friendly interfaces, have made online shopping more accessible and enjoyable. Retailers are leveraging these technologies to enhance the customer experience.

3. **Changing Consumer Behavior**: Today's consumers are more informed and empowered than ever before. They conduct extensive research before making purchases, often relying on online reviews and social media recommendations. This shift in behavior has led to an increased demand for transparency and authenticity from brands.

C. Impact of the COVID-19 Pandemic on E-commerce

The COVID-19 pandemic acted as a catalyst for e-commerce growth, as lockdowns and social distancing measures forced consumers to turn to online shopping. Many businesses that previously relied on brick-and-mortar sales quickly adapted to the digital landscape, leading to a surge in hot-selling products across various categories, from home fitness equipment to kitchen gadgets.

III. Key Development Trends in Hot-Selling Products

As the e-commerce landscape continues to evolve, several key trends are shaping the market for hot-selling products.

A. Personalization and Customization

1. **Importance of Tailored Shopping Experiences**: Consumers increasingly expect personalized shopping experiences that cater to their individual preferences. Retailers are responding by offering customized product recommendations and tailored marketing messages.

2. **Use of AI and Data Analytics**: Artificial intelligence (AI) and data analytics play a crucial role in understanding consumer behavior and preferences. Retailers can analyze customer data to create targeted marketing campaigns and improve product offerings.

3. **Examples of Successful Personalized Product Offerings**: Brands like Nike and Coca-Cola have successfully implemented personalization strategies, allowing customers to customize products to their liking, resulting in increased customer satisfaction and loyalty.

B. Sustainability and Eco-Friendly Products

1. **Growing Consumer Awareness and Demand for Sustainable Options**: As environmental concerns rise, consumers are increasingly seeking sustainable and eco-friendly products. This trend is particularly prominent among younger generations who prioritize ethical consumption.

2. **Trends in Eco-Friendly Packaging and Materials**: Brands are adopting sustainable packaging solutions, such as biodegradable materials and minimalistic designs, to reduce their environmental impact. This shift not only appeals to eco-conscious consumers but also enhances brand reputation.

3. **Case Studies of Brands Leading in Sustainability**: Companies like Patagonia and Uncommon Goods have built their brands around sustainability, successfully attracting a loyal customer base that values ethical practices.

C. Subscription-Based Models

1. **Overview of Subscription Services in Various Industries**: Subscription-based models have gained popularity across various sectors, from beauty and fashion to food and entertainment. These services offer consumers convenience and curated experiences.

2. **Benefits for Consumers and Businesses**: Subscription models provide consumers with regular access to products while allowing businesses to generate predictable revenue streams. This model fosters customer loyalty and encourages repeat purchases.

3. **Examples of Successful Subscription-Based Hot-Selling Products**: Brands like Dollar Shave Club and Birchbox have disrupted traditional retail by offering subscription services that deliver hot-selling products directly to consumers' doors.

D. Social Commerce and Influencer Marketing

1. **The Rise of Social Media as a Sales Platform**: Social media platforms have evolved into powerful sales channels, allowing brands to reach consumers where they spend a significant amount of their time. Features like shoppable posts and live shopping events have transformed the way products are marketed.

2. **Role of Influencers in Promoting Hot-Selling Products**: Influencer marketing has become a key strategy for brands looking to promote their products. Influencers leverage their followers' trust to drive sales and create buzz around hot-selling items.

3. **Case Studies of Successful Social Commerce Strategies**: Brands like Glossier and Gymshark have effectively utilized social commerce and influencer partnerships to build strong online communities and drive sales.

E. Integration of Augmented Reality (AR) and Virtual Reality (VR)

1. **Enhancing the Online Shopping Experience**: AR and VR technologies are revolutionizing the online shopping experience by allowing consumers to visualize products in their own environments. This immersive experience helps reduce uncertainty and increases purchase confidence.

2. **Examples of AR/VR Applications in Product Visualization**: Retailers like IKEA and Sephora have implemented AR features that enable customers to see how furniture fits in their homes or try on makeup virtually, enhancing the overall shopping experience.

3. **Future Potential of AR/VR in E-commerce**: As AR and VR technologies continue to advance, their integration into e-commerce is expected to grow, providing even more engaging and interactive shopping experiences.

F. Mobile Commerce (M-commerce)

1. **Growth of Mobile Shopping**: With the proliferation of smartphones, mobile commerce has become a significant driver of e-commerce growth. Consumers increasingly prefer to shop on their mobile devices, leading to the rise of mobile-optimized websites and apps.

2. **Importance of Mobile Optimization for Online Stores**: Retailers must prioritize mobile optimization to ensure a seamless shopping experience. This includes fast loading times, user-friendly interfaces, and easy navigation.

3. **Trends in Mobile Payment Solutions**: The adoption of mobile payment solutions, such as digital wallets and contactless payments, has made transactions more convenient for consumers, further fueling the growth of m-commerce.

IV. Emerging Technologies Shaping the Industry

As the online store industry evolves, emerging technologies are playing a pivotal role in shaping its future.

A.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ning

1. **Role in Inventory Management and Demand Forecasting**: AI and machine learning algorithms help retailers optimize inventory management by predicting demand patterns and minimizing stockouts or overstock situations.

2. **Enhancing Customer Service Through Chatbots**: Chatbots powered by AI provide instant customer support, answering queries and assisting with purchases, thereby improving the overall shopping experience.

3. **Personalization Through AI Algorithms**: AI algorithms analyze customer behavior to deliver personalized product recommendations, enhancing the likelihood of conversions.

B. Blockchain Technology

1. **Impact on Supply Chain Transparency**: Blockchain technology enhances supply chain transparency by providing a secure and immutable record of transactions. This transparency builds trust between consumers and brands.

2. **Enhancing Security in Transactions**: Blockchain's decentralized nature enhances security in online transactions, reducing the risk of fraud and data breaches.

3. **Potential for Loyalty Programs and Digital Currencies**: Blockchain can facilitate innovative loyalty programs and the use of digital currencies, providing consumers with more options and rewards for their purchases.

C. Internet of Things (IoT)

1. **Smart Devices and Their Influence on Shopping Habits**: IoT devices, such as smart speakers and wearables, are influencing shopping habits by enabling voice-activated purchases and personalized recommendations.

2. **Examples of IoT Applications in E-commerce**: Retailers are leveraging IoT technology to track consumer behavior, manage inventory, and enhance the overall shopping experience.

3. **Future Implications for Online Retailers**: As IoT technology continues to advance, online retailers will need to adapt to new consumer behaviors and preferences driven by smart devices.

Consumers often prefer products that seamlessly integrate into their existing ecosystems. IV. Comparative Analysis of Best-Selling Models A. Smartphones 1. Apple iPhone vs. Samsung Galaxy The Apple iPhone and Samsung Galaxy series are two of the most popular smartphone lines globally. Operating System Differences (iOS vs. Android): The iPhone runs on Apple's iOS, known for its smooth user experience and regular updates. In contrast, Samsung's Galaxy series operates on Android, offering more customization options but varying update schedules. Camera Capabilities: Both brands excel in camera technology, but the iPhone is often praised for its color accuracy and video capabilities, while Samsung tends to offer more versatile camera features, including higher megapixel counts. Build Quality and Design: Apple is known for its premium materials and minimalist design, while Samsung offers a range of designs, from sleek to bold, catering to different consumer preferences. Ecosystem Integration: Apple's ecosystem, including iCloud, Apple Watch, and AirPods, provides seamless integration, while Samsung's Galaxy ecosystem offers compatibility with a wide range of devices, including smart home products. 2. Google Pixel vs. OnePlus Software Experience: The Google Pixel is renowned for its pure Android experience and timely updates, while OnePlus offers a customized version of Android (OxygenOS) that emphasizes speed and performance. Performance and Hardware: Both brands offer competitive hardware, but the Pixel often excels in computational photography, while OnePlus focuses on high refresh rates and gaming performance. Price-to-Value Ratio: OnePlus is known for providing flagship features at a lower price point, making it an attractive option for budget-conscious consumers. B. Laptops 1. MacBook Air vs. Dell XPS Performance Benchmarks: The MacBook Air, powered by Apple's M1 chip, offers impressive performance and efficiency, while the Dell XPS series is known for its powerful Intel processors and high-performance graphics options. Portability and Battery Life: The MacBook Air is lightweight and boasts exceptional battery life, making it ideal for on-the-go users. The Dell XPS is also portable but may vary in battery performance depending on the configuration. Operating System Advantages: The choice between macOS and Windows can significantly influence consumer preferences, with macOS appealing to creative professionals and Windows being favored for gaming and business applications. 2. HP Spectre vs. Lenovo ThinkPad Design and Build Quality: The HP Spectre is known for its premium design and aesthetics, while the Lenovo ThinkPad is celebrated for its durability and robust keyboard, appealing to business users. Target Audience and Use Cases: The Spectre targets consumers looking for style and performance, while the ThinkPad is designed for professionals who prioritize functionality and reliability. C. Tablets 1. Apple iPad vs. Samsung Galaxy Tab App Ecosystem and Productivity: The iPad benefits from a vast app ecosystem, particularly for creative and productivity applications. The Galaxy Tab offers a more versatile Android experience but may lack some specialized apps. Display Quality and Performance: Both tablets offer high-quality displays, but the iPad is often praised for its color accuracy and brightness, making it ideal for media consumption. 2. Microsoft Surface vs. Android Tablets Versatility and Use Cases: The Microsoft Surface is designed for productivity, functioning as both a tablet and a laptop, while Android tablets cater more to casual users and media consumption. Software Compatibility: The Surface runs Windows, allowing for full desktop applications, while Android tablets may have limitations in software compatibility. D. Smartwatches 1. Apple Watch vs. Samsung Galaxy Watch Health and Fitness Features: The Apple Watch is known for its comprehensive health tracking features, including ECG and blood oxygen monitoring. The Galaxy Watch also offers robust health features but may vary by model. Integration with Smartphones: The Apple Watch integrates seamlessly with iPhones, while the Galaxy Watch offers compatibility with both Android and iOS, though with limited features on iOS. 2. Fitbit vs. Garmin Target Audience and Functionality: Fitbit focuses on fitness tracking and health monitoring, appealing to casual users, while Garmin targets serious athletes with advanced metrics and GPS capabilities. Design and Usability: Fitbit devices are often more stylish and user-friendly, while Garmin watches are designed for durability and functionality in outdoor activities. E. Televisions 1. LG OLED vs. Samsung QLED Picture Quality and Technology: LG's OLED technology is known for its deep blacks and vibrant colors, while Samsung's QLED offers bright images and excellent color accuracy, particularly in well-lit rooms. Smart Features and User Interface: Both brands offer smart features, but the user interface and app availability may differ, influencing consumer preferences. 2. Sony Bravia vs. TCL Price vs. Performance: Sony Bravia TVs are often priced higher due to their premium build and picture quality, while TCL offers budget-friendly options with competitive performance. Brand Loyalty and Reputation: Sony has a long-standing reputation for quality, while TCL is gaining recognition for providing value for money. F. Home Assistants 1. Amazon Echo vs. Google Nest Voice Recognition and AI Capabilities: Amazon Echo devices excel in voice recognition and smart home integration, while Google Nest offers superior search capabilities and integration with Google services. Ecosystem Compatibility: Both devices work well within their respective ecosystems, but consumers may prefer one over the other based on their existing smart home devices. 2. Apple HomePod vs. Sonos Sound Quality and Design: The HomePod is known for its exceptional sound quality and sleek design, while Sonos offers a range of speakers with multi-room capabilities. Integration with Other Devices: The HomePod integrates seamlessly with Apple devices, while Sonos supports a wider range of streaming services and smart home platforms. V. What industries are the application scenarios of stainless steel resistors included in?
What are the application scenarios of stainless steel resistors in various industries? IntroductionStainless steel resistors are important components widely used in electronic devices and industrial systems. They are favored for their superior corrosion resistance, high temperature resistance, and stability, making them an indispensable part of many industries. With the continuous progress of technology and the diversification of industrial demands, the application scenarios of stainless steel resistors are constantly expanding. This article will explore the basic principles, main application industries, advantages, and future development trends of stainless steel resistors. I. Basic Principles of Stainless Steel Resistors Working Principle of ResistorsA resistor is an electronic component that restricts the flow of electric current, and its working principle is based on Ohm's Law (V=IR), where voltage (V) equals the product of current (I) and resistance (R). Resistors control the flow of current by converting electrical energy into heat. The resistance characteristics of different materials determine the performance and applications of resistors. Resistance Characteristics of Stainless Steel MaterialsStainless steel is an alloy material composed mainly of iron, chromium, and nickel. Its superior corrosion resistance and mechanical strength make it an ideal choice for manufacturing resistors. Compared to traditional carbon resistors, stainless steel resistors exhibit more stability in high temperature and humid environments, effectively reducing failure rates. Manufacturing Process of Stainless Steel ResistorsThe manufacturing process of stainless steel resistors typically includes material selection, forming, welding, and surface treatment steps. By precisely controlling these process parameters, the performance of resistors can meet design requirements. Furthermore, advancements in modern manufacturing technology have significantly improved the production efficiency and quality of stainless steel resistors. II. Main Application Industries of Stainless Steel Resistors 1. Electronics IndustryIn the electronics industry, stainless steel resistors are widely used in signal processing on circuit boards. They play a crucial role in various electronic devices such as mobile phones, computers, and household appliances. Due to the high requirements for stability and reliability in electronic devices, the corrosion resistance and high temperature resistance of stainless steel resistors make them an ideal choice. 2. Automotive IndustryIn the automotive industry, stainless steel resistors are applied in automotive electronic systems such as sensors and control units. They can enhance the safety and performance of vehicles, ensuring reliable operation under various driving conditions. With the rise of electric and smart vehicles, the demand for high-performance resistors is continuously increasing. 3. Medical IndustryMedical devices have extremely high requirements for materials, and stainless steel resistors are widely used in monitoring instruments and imaging equipment. Their biocompatibility and corrosion resistance allow for safe use in medical environments, ensuring the long-term stability and reliability of equipment. 4. Industrial AutomationIn the field of industrial automation, stainless steel resistors are widely used in sensors and actuators of automated equipment. They can improve production efficiency and safety, ensuring the normal operation of equipment in harsh environments. With the advancement of Industry 4.0, the demand for high-performance resistors will further increase. 5. Aerospace IndustryThe aerospace industry has strict requirements for materials, and stainless steel resistors are widely used in aerospace electronic equipment. Their ability to withstand high temperatures and pressures allows them to operate stably in extreme environments, ensuring the safety and reliability of aircraft. 6. Energy IndustryIn renewable energy equipment such as solar inverters, the application of stainless steel resistors is becoming more common. Additionally, they play a crucial role in current measurement in power systems. With the global emphasis on renewable energy, the market demand for stainless steel resistors will continue to grow. 7. Food and Beverage IndustryFood processing equipment has high requirements for hygiene and safety, and stainless steel resistors are widely used in applications such as temperature control. Their corrosion resistance and ease of cleaning make them an ideal choice for the food industry, ensuring the safety and hygiene of the food processing process. 8. Chemical IndustryIn the chemical industry, stainless steel resistors are applied in chemical reaction equipment such as reactors and sensors. Their corrosion resistance is crucial in chemical reaction processes, ensuring the long-term stable operation of equipment and reducing maintenance costs. III. Advantages of Stainless Steel ResistorsThe advantages of stainless steel resistors are mainly reflected in the following aspects: Corrosion Resistance and High Temperature ResistanceStainless steel materials have excellent corrosion resistance, allowing them to be used for long periods in humid and corrosive environments. Additionally, their high temperature resistance enables them to operate stably in high-temperature conditions, adapting to various harsh environments. Stability and ReliabilityStainless steel resistors demonstrate good stability and reliability in long-term use, effectively reducing failure rates. This is particularly important for industries that require high reliability, such as medical and aerospace. Ability to Adapt to Various Harsh EnvironmentsStainless steel resistors can operate normally in extreme temperatures, humidity, chemical corrosion, and other harsh environments, ensuring the stable operation of equipment. This makes them widely used in industries such as industrial automation, chemical, and energy. IV. What are the development trends in the hot-selling electronic products industry?
Development Trends in the Hot-Selling Electronic Products Industry I. Introduction The electronic products industry has become a cornerstone of modern life, influencing how we communicate, work, and entertain ourselves. With rapid advancements in technology and shifting consumer preferences, understanding the development trends in this sector is crucial for businesses, investors, and consumers alike. This article aims to explore the current landscape of the electronic products industry, highlighting key trends that are shaping its future. II. Current Landscape of the Electronic Products Industry The electronic products industry has witnessed remarkable growth over the past decade. According to recent market research, the global consumer electronics market was valued at approximately $1 trillion in 2022 and is projected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around 6% through 2030. Major players in this space include tech giants like Apple, Samsung, and Sony, alongside emerging companies that are innovating rapidly. Consumer behavior is also evolving, with a growing preference for smart, connected devices. Today's consumers are not just looking for functionality; they seek products that enhance their lifestyle, offer convenience, and integrate seamlessly into their daily routines. This shift in consumer expectations is driving manufacturers to innovate continuously. III. Technological Advancements A. Rise of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ning Artificial Intelligence (AI) and machine learning are revolutionizing the electronic products industry. From smart assistants like Amazon's Alexa to AI-driven cameras that enhance photography, these technologies are becoming integral to consumer electronics. The integration of AI improves user experience by personalizing interactions and automating tasks, making devices more intuitive and user-friendly. B. Internet of Things (IoT) and Smart Devices The Internet of Things (IoT) is another significant trend, with smart home products gaining traction. Devices such as smart thermostats, security cameras, and lighting systems are becoming commonplace, allowing users to control their environments remotely. The growth of IoT is driven by the demand for connectivity and interoperability, enabling devices to communicate with each other and create a cohesive smart home ecosystem. C. 5G Technology The rollout of 5G technology is set to enhance connectivity for mobile devices, enabling faster data transfer and more reliable connections. This advancement opens up new possibilities for product development, particularly in areas like augmented reality (AR) and virtual reality (VR), where high-speed internet is essential for seamless experiences. As 5G becomes more widespread, we can expect a surge in innovative electronic products that leverage this technology. IV. Sustainability and Eco-Friendly Products As environmental concerns grow, consumers are increasingly demanding sustainable electronics. Companies are responding by innovating in materials and manufacturing processes to reduce their carbon footprint. For instance, many brands are exploring biodegradable materials and energy-efficient production methods. Regulatory pressures are also influencing the industry, with governments implementing stricter guidelines on electronic waste and sustainability practices. Corporate responsibility is becoming a key focus, as companies recognize the importance of aligning their operations with environmental values to attract eco-conscious consumers. V. Health and Wellness Technology The COVID-19 pandemic has accelerated the adoption of health and wellness technology, particularly in the realm of wearables. Fitness trackers and smartwatches have gained popularity as consumers seek to monitor their health and fitness levels more closely. Additionally, health monitoring devices, such as blood pressure monitors and glucose trackers, are becoming essential tools for managing chronic conditions. The pandemic has also highlighted the importance of telehealth solutions, leading to increased demand for devices that facilitate remote consultations and health monitoring. As the health tech sector continues to evolve, we can expect further innovations that prioritize user health and well-being. VI. E-commerce and Distribution Trends The shift towards online shopping has transformed the way consumers purchase electronic products. E-commerce platforms have become the primary sales channel for many brands, offering convenience and a wider selection of products. Social media and influencer marketing play a crucial role in shaping consumer preferences, as brands leverage these platforms to reach their target audiences effectively. Innovations in logistics and supply chain management are also enhancing the e-commerce experience. Companies are investing in advanced technologies, such as AI and automation, to streamline operations and improve delivery times, ensuring that consumers receive their products quickly and efficiently. VII. Customization and Personalization Today's consumers are increasingly seeking tailored electronic products that reflect their individual preferences. This demand for customization is driving advancements in manufacturing technologies, such as 3D printing, which allows for the creation of unique products at scale. Brands are also engaging consumers through customization options, enabling them to personalize features, colors, and designs. This trend not only enhances customer satisfaction but also fosters brand loyalty, as consumers feel a deeper connection to products that are uniquely theirs. VIII. Emerging Markets and Global Trends The electronic products industry is experiencing significant growth in emerging markets, where rising disposable incomes and increasing access to technology are driving demand. Cultural influences play a vital role in shaping electronic product preferences, as consumers in different regions prioritize various features and functionalities. However, challenges remain in global markets, including regulatory hurdles, supply chain disruptions, and competition from local brands. Companies that can navigate these challenges while adapting to local preferences will find ample opportunities for growth. IX.
